Bathroom Remodeling Trends and Benefits
Modern bathroom remodeling incorporates innovative designs and features that enhance functionality and aesthetic appeal. Recent trends focus on creating spa-like environments, maximizing space, and integrating smart technology for convenience and efficiency.
Bathrooms now feature walk-in showers with glass enclosures and rainfall showerheads for a luxurious experience.
Clean lines, neutral palettes, and sleek fixtures define the minimalist approach popular in current remodels.
Touchless faucets, heated floors, and smart mirrors are transforming bathroom functionality.
Updating bathrooms with current trends can increase property value, improve energy efficiency, and provide a more relaxing environment.
Trends allow for customization, blending style and practicality to suit individual preferences.
Styles range from sleek modern to rustic farmhouse, each emphasizing unique elements like textured tiles, bold fixtures, or vintage accents.
Recent trends in bathroom remodeling reveal a preference for larger, more open layouts and the use of natural light. The integration of innovative fixtures and eco-conscious materials continues to shape design choices, making bathrooms more functional and visually appealing.
Expansive walk-in showers with frameless glass doors are increasingly favored for their modern look.
Floating vanities create a sense of space and add a contemporary touch.
Use of marble, quartz, and other natural stones adds elegance and durability.
Incorporating vintage-inspired fixtures adds character and charm to modern designs.
| Bathroom Style | Key Features |
|---|---|
| Modern | Minimalist fixtures, neutral tones, sleek lines |
| Rustic | Wood accents, textured tiles, vintage fixtures |
| Industrial | Metal finishes, exposed pipes, concrete surfaces |
| Spa-Inspired | Rain showers, soaking tubs, ambient lighting |
| Traditional | Decorative moldings, classic fixtures, warm colors |
